The future of Purse.io is unclear after the company announced closure in April 2020 only to change its mind a week later.

On 16 April 2020, Purse.io advised its users to withdraw their funds because it would cease operations on June 26, 2020.

“[We have] made the very difficult decision to dissolve the company,” Purse wrote in a statement. Although the company has since reconsidered this position as it seeks new ownership, you can start shopping for other platforms.

In this guide, you will discover five alternatives to Purse.io.

Bitrefill

Bitrefill is a Stockholm-based company that offers users a place to buy gift cards and to top up mobile phones with Bitcoin and other cryptocurrencies. The company aims to make it easy for people to live on crypto.

On Bitrefill you can:

· Shop and pay with the latest Lightning Network technology

· Buy digital gift cards from companies like Steam, Roblox, hotels.com, Skype, and Onetify

· Top up prepaid mobile phones for numbers in 160 countries with BTC or other supported cryptocurrencies

Bitrefill, which was founded in 2014, allows users to shop without creating an account.

CoinCola

CoinCola is a crypto marketplace that offers gift card trading as one of its services. The Hong Kong-based company allows users to buy gift cards with Bitcoin.

As a CoinCola user, you can do the following:

· Undertake OTC trades

· Buy gift cards like Sephora, American Express, iTunes, and Steam with BTC from traders

· Perform crypto to crypto trades

You will need to create an account to use CoinCola’s services. The company claims to offer competitive fees and a KYC process that observes the safety and security of users.

Pamcoins

Note: Pamcoins may no longer be in business

Pamcoins is a Nigerian gift card exchange platform that launched in 2017. On this platform, you can sell gift cards and receive payment in Naira, Bitcoin, and Ethereum. Interestingly, the platform carries out its trade via WhatsApp. Therefore, to initiate a trade, you will have to contact the company through the phone number on the website.

The benefits of using Pamcoins include:

· The option to trade on Paxful

· The ability to carry out transactions in person

· You will get the best market rates

· You can view proof of payment from other trades

· You only need a WhatsApp account to initiate a trade with Pamcoins.
